Abstract
This thesis explores the application of Virtual Reality (VR) technology to enhance agricultural education and training programs. The integration of VR in agricultural education presents a unique opportunity to revolutionize traditional teaching methods and provide immersive learning experiences for students and professionals in the agricultural sector. This research investigates the potential benefits, challenges, and implications of incorporating VR technology into agricultural education and training programs.

Thesis Overview
The project titled "Utilizing Virtual Reality Technology to Enhance Agricultural Education and Training Programs" aims to explore the potential benefits and applications of virtual reality (VR) technology in the field of agricultural education and training. This research seeks to address the growing need for innovative and effective methods to enhance learning experiences in agriculture, with a specific focus on leveraging VR technology to create immersive and interactive training programs.
The main objective of this study is to investigate how VR technology can be integrated into agricultural education to improve knowledge retention, practical skills development, and overall learning outcomes for students and professionals in the agricultural sector. By utilizing VR simulations and immersive environments, learners can engage in realistic scenarios, practice hands-on tasks, and experience various aspects of agricultural practices in a safe and controlled setting.
